Things you need to know before you sign up online for the CAEL test

Requirements for the room

  • Your test site needs to be indoors, walled in, well-lit, with a closed door, peaceful, and silent.

  • Only you should be in the testing room.

  • There shouldn't be any extra paper on your test station. No studying items should be close by.

  • You can bring two tissues with you, but the proctor will need to check them out before the test starts.

  • It is not permissible to take notes with a pen and paper. You need to use the ProProctor Scratchpad to take notes.

  • Water in a clear bottle is the only thing that can be brought into the testing room. Food is not allowed.

Requirements for the system

  • You need check at the ProProctor User Guide on the CAEL website before you register up for the test.

  • Make sure you have the ProProctor app on your computer to give the downloaded test.

  • Ensure you have a laptop or desktop. Smartphones and tablets are not allowed to take the test.

  • It's necessary to have at least 2Mb/s of download speed and 1Mb/s of upload speed.

  • The necessary web browser is Chrome (the most recent version).

  • You need a camera, a microphone, and speakers.

  • It is against the rules to use Bluetooth devices, such as wireless speakers, laptops, and mice.

  • Minimum screen size that is recommended is 1024x768.

  • The running systems that can be used are Windows 8.1 or later and Mac OS 10.13.

  • On a workplace laptop, you might not be able to take the test unless you ask your company's IT to set it up for you.

  • You can't start the ProProctor program from a virtual machine or a remote desktop connection.

Requirements for ID

  • You need to provide a genuine ID from the government that you will show on the day of the test. Visit the CAEL website to see a list of valid IDs given by the government.

  • Make an account with the CAEL and upload a picture of yourself.

Requirements for security checks

  • You will need to use video chat to verify your identity.

  • You will be asked to check your test station from all angles. Get rid of everything that you don't need first.

  • Through the live chat, you will also have to give a 360-degree scan of yourself.

How much does the Canadian Academic English Language Assessment test cost?

The Canadian price for the CAEL 2023 test is $280 plus taxes. Prices will be different for people in other countries. You can find out more about these prices on the official CAEL page.

How long does CAEL take?

It takes three hours and thirty minutes to finish the CAEL test.

Format of the CAEL test

There are 5 parts to the CAEL test: Speaking, Integrated Reading, Integrated Listening, Academic Unit A, and Academic Unit B.

Speaking: You will have to speak your answers to the on-screen questions in this part. This part has been given 7–10 minutes of time.

Integrated Reading: This part of the test will have you read sections and answer questions at the same time. This part has been given 35 to 50 minutes of time.

Integrated Listening: You have to listen to passages and answer questions in this part. This part has been given 25 to 35 minutes of time.

Academic Unit A: You have to answer comprehension questions and write an answer in this part. This part has been given 60 to 70 minutes of time.

Academic Unit B: You have to answer comprehension questions and write an answer in this part. This part has been given 40 to 45 minutes of time.

Scores on the CAEL 2023 test

If you want to win the CAEL 2023 awards, you can get a score between 10 and 90 and read about what each number means.

In addition to your total grade, you will also get individual scores for reading, listening, writing, and speaking English.

The end score will be found by averaging the four component scores.

This score will be rounded to the nearest ten-point interval and given equal weight. 

Checking your CAEL results

You can check your CAEL exam results online eight business days after the test date through your CAEL account.

You will get an email when the results of your CAEL test are ready. 

There are no weekends or holidays in the work days.

There is no extra charge to send your CAEL scores to five different schools. 

You can list the schools where you want to send your score when you register online or up to one business day before your test results are made public online.

The final score reports will be mailed to these schools. 

You can get more Official Score Reports through your CAEL Account for CAD 20.00. For an extra fee, you can pay for fast shipping through your CAEL Account.

CAEL test sites for 2023

The CAEL test can be taken in more than 40 places around the world, in places like Canada, China, India, the Philippines, Mexico, the Republic of Korea, and the United Arab Emirates.

What organizations will take CAEL 2023 scores?

There are many schools in Alberta, British Columbia, Manitoba, New Brunswick, Newfoundland, the Northwest Territories, Nova Scotia, Ontario, Prince Edward Island, Quebec, Saskatchewan, the Yukon Territory, and the United States that accept the CAEL. 

The CAEL 2023 is also recognized by groups of professionals.

You can find a list of schools and business groups that accept CAEL scores on the official website of the CAEL.
